در نرم‌افزار اکسل شیوه‌ی نمایش اعداد و به عنوان مثال تعداد اعداد پس از اعشار قابل تنظیم است اما به جز تغییر ظاهری در نمایش اعداد، می‌توان از توابعی برای رند کردن و گرد کردن اعداد استفاده کرد. به عنوان مثال می‌توانید عددی با ارقام پس از اعشار را به عدد بالاتر گرد کنید و یا به عدد پایین‌تر و رند تبدیل کنید. این کار با استفاده از سه تابع ROUND و ROUNDUP و ROUNDDOWN در نرم‌افزار Excel مجموعه آفیس مایکروسافت انجام می‌شود.

در ادامه با سیاره‌ی آی‌تی همراه باشید تا روش رند کردن اعداد در نرم‌افزار اکسل مایکروسافت را با سه تابع مفید و کاربردی بررسی کنیم.

اعداد پس از ممیز در اکسل

تغییر دادن شیوه‌ی نمایش اعداد برای منظم شدن صفحات و جداول اکسل بسیار خوب و کاربردی است و خطایی در محاسبات بعدی با استفاده از داده‌ها ایجاد نمی‌کند. در واقع در محاسبات از همان مقدار اصلی و واقعی عدد‌ها استفاده می‌شود و صرفاً نمایش عدد است که به منظور کوتاه‌تر شدن عدد و یکسان شدن طول اعداد سلول‌های مختلف، تغییر کرده است. قبلاً به روش تنظیم کردن تعداد اعداد پس از ممیز و حتی قبل از ممیز در Excel‌ اشاره کردیم:

اما راهکار بعدی برای کوتاه کردن اعداد این است که بخش اعشاری را با استفاده از تابع ROUND حذف کنیم. این تابع در صورتی که عدد پس از اعشار، بزرگ‌تر یا مساوی ۵ باشد، رقم یکان را یک واحد بیشتر می‌کند و اگر ۰ الی ۴ باشد، بخش اعشاری را حذف می‌کند. البته محدود به ارقام پس از اعشار نیستید و می‌توانید اعدادی که می‌خواهید تعداد خاصی عدد پس از اعشار داشته باشند را با تابع ROUND، کوتاه کنید و حتی ارقام قبل از اعشار را به بالا یا پایین، رند کنید! به عنوان مثال اگر نیاز به اعداد اعشاری با ۱ رقم اعشار یا بیشتر داشته باشید، می‌توانید اعداد بعدی را حذف کنید و آخرین رقم اعشار را به کمک تابع ROUND بی‌تغییر یا یک واحد بیشتر کنید.

با مثال‌های عددی وضعیت روشن می‌شود: با تابع رند می‌توانید عدد 8.532 را به 8.53 و عدد 8.535 را به 8.54 تبدیل کنید. موقعیتی که در این مثال تابع رند روی آن کار کرده، دو رقم پس از اعشار است.

تابع‌های مشابه ROUNDDOWN و ROUNDUP مشابه تابع ROUND عمل می‌کنند اما رندداون همیشه عدد کوچک‌تر و رندآپ همواره عدد بزرگ‌تر را به جای عدد اصلی قرار می‌دهد و در واقع به عدد بعدی که می‌توانید ۰ تا ۹ باشد، توجه نمی‌کنند.

بدیهی است که می‌توانید از تابع‌های رند کردن اعداد در فرمول‌های پیچیده هم استفاده کنید. به عنوان مثال ابتدا با تابع SUM جمع بزنید و سپس تابع SUM را در تابع ROUND استفاده کنید تا حاصل‌جمع به صورت رند محاسبه شود و همین‌طور می‌توانید ابتدا هر یک از سلول‌ها را رند کنید و سپس حاصل‌جمع را محاسبه کنید که خطای کمتری خواهد داشت.

آموزش رند کردن اعداد با تابع ROUND در اکسل

فرض کنید در ستونی به اسم Values، مقادیر اولین را دارید و می‌خواهید در ستون Results یا نتایج، مقدار رندشده‌ی همان اعداد خام با سه رقم اعشاری را داشته باشید.

ابتدا سلول نتیجه از سطر اول را انتخاب کنید.

آموزش حذف اعشار و گرد یا رند کردن اعداد در Excel با تابع ROUND

کلید = کیبورد را فشار دهید و تابع ROUND را تایپ کنید و یا برای سادگی بیشتر و استفاده از پنجره‌ی توابع، روی منوی Formulas بالای صفحه کلیک کنید.

آموزش حذف اعشار و گرد یا رند کردن اعداد در Excel با تابع ROUND

روی گزینه‌ی Math & Trig کلیک کنید تا منوی کرکره‌ای آن باز شود.

آموزش حذف اعشار و گرد یا رند کردن اعداد در Excel با تابع ROUND

در منوی کرکره‌ای اسکرول کنید تا به گزینه‌ی ROUND برسید و روی آن کلیک کنید.

آموزش حذف اعشار و گرد یا رند کردن اعداد در Excel با تابع ROUND

در پنجره‌ی باز شده، دو ورودی موردنیاز است. ورودی اول یا Number در حقیقت مقدار اولیه یا سلول حاوی عدد اصلی است. ورودی دوم یا Num_digits نیز تعداد ارقام موردنیاز است.

آموزش حذف اعشار و گرد یا رند کردن اعداد در Excel با تابع ROUND

ابتدا روی فیلد اول کلیک کنید و سپس روی سلول اول از ستون Values کلیک کنید.

البته دقت کنید که در این فیلد می‌توانید یک عدد را به صورت دستی هم تایپ کنید. در این صورت حتی اگر سلول‌های اولیه دیلیت شوند هم تابع رند مقدار رندشده‌ی عددی که تایپ کرده‌اید را نمایش می‌دهد.

آموزش حذف اعشار و گرد یا رند کردن اعداد در Excel با تابع ROUND

در دومین فیلد یعنی Num_digits با توجه به اینکه در مثال ما هدف این است که اعداد را با سه رقم اعشاری استفاده کنیم، عدد ۳ را وارد کنید.

آموزش حذف اعشار و گرد یا رند کردن اعداد در Excel با تابع ROUND

سپس روی OK کلیک کنید.

آموزش حذف اعشار و گرد یا رند کردن اعداد در Excel با تابع ROUND

و اما چند نکته در مورد Num_digits:

  • اگر عدد طبیعی یعنی ۱ و ۲ و ... وارد کنید، پس از اعشار، همین تعداد رقم باقی می‌ماند.
  • اگر عدد ۰ وارد کنید، عددی بدون رقم پس از اعشار خواهید داشت که ممکن است یکان آن یک واحد بیشتر باشد یا مثل عدد قبلی باشد و این بستگی به اولین رقم پس از اعشار دارد.
  • اگر از اعداد صحیح اما منفی استفاده کنید، ارقام قبل از اعشار هم رند می‌شود. به عنوان مثال اگر منفی ۱ را در فیلد Num_digits تایپ کنید و عدد ورودی 328.25 باشد، نتیجه عدد ۳۳۰ است. اگر از عدد منفی ۳ استفاده کنید و ورودی شما عدد 501 باشد، به ۱۰۰۰ تبدیل می‌شود و اگر ورودی شما 499 باشد به ۰ تبدیل می‌شود.

به علاوه می‌توانید مستقیماً فرمول را بدون استفاده از منوها تایپ کنید مثل مورد زیر:

آموزش حذف اعشار و گرد یا رند کردن اعداد در Excel با تابع ROUND

و نتایج سه رقمی کردن اعشار:

آموزش حذف اعشار و گرد یا رند کردن اعداد در Excel با تابع ROUND

برای تکرار کردن فرمول تایپ‌شده برای سطرهای بعدی، روی مربع کوچکی که پس از انتخاب کردن سلول اول در گوشه‌ی راست و پایین آن نمایان می‌شود کلیک کنید و موس را به سمت پایین حرکت دهید و تا جایی که لازم است پیش بروید و سپس کلید چپ موس را رها کنید.

آموزش حذف اعشار و گرد یا رند کردن اعداد در Excel با تابع ROUND

دقت کنید که حین درگ کردن به این سبک، آیکون موس به شکل + تغییر می‌کند.

آموزش حذف اعشار و گرد یا رند کردن اعداد در Excel با تابع ROUND

و به این ترتیب فرمول شما در سلول‌های بعدی کپی می‌شود و البته سلول ورودی نیز به تناسب سطر، تغییر می‌کند.

آموزش حذف اعشار و گرد یا رند کردن اعداد در Excel با تابع ROUND

تایپ کردن توابع با نوار Function اکسل

همان‌طور که قبلاً اشاره کردیم می‌توانید در سلول‌ها با تایپ کردن = شروع به فرمول‌نویسی کنید که سریع‌ترین روش برای کاربرانی است که توابع موردنیاز خود را می‌شناسند و دقیقاً می‌دانند که هر تابعی که لازم دارند، چند آرگومان به عنوان ورودی لازم دارد و چطور باید آرگومان‌ها را تایپ کرد.

اما روش دیگر که نسبتاً‌ سریع است، استفاده از نوار فانکشن بالای صفحه است. ابتدا روی سلول موردنظر کلیک کنید تا انتخاب شود.

آموزش حذف اعشار و گرد یا رند کردن اعداد در Excel با تابع ROUND

سپس روی نوار Function که کنار آن عبارت fx درج شده، کلیک کنید.

آموزش حذف اعشار و گرد یا رند کردن اعداد در Excel با تابع ROUND

اکنون تابع را تایپ کنید که در مورد تابع ROUND به صورت زیر است:

=ROUND(number,num_digits)

در دستور فوق باید به جای دو آرگومان تابع، سلول مبدأ و همین‌طور تعداد اعشار لازم را تایپ کرد.

آموزش حذف اعشار و گرد یا رند کردن اعداد در Excel با تابع ROUND

با فشار دادن کلید Enter، تایپ کردن تابع تکمیل می‌شود و می‌توانید نتیجه را بررسی کنید:

آموزش حذف اعشار و گرد یا رند کردن اعداد در Excel با تابع ROUND

استفاده از توابع ROUNDUP و ROUNDDOWN در Excel

اگر بخواهید همواره اعداد را با بریدن مقدار اعشاری اضافی، رند کنید، باید از تابع ROUNDDOWN استفاده کنید و اگر بخواهید همواره مقدار اعشاری اضافی را برش بزنید و اولین رقم سمت راست را یک واحد بیشتر کنید، می‌بایست از تابع ROUNDUP استفاده کنید. البته اگر موقعیت اعشار را عدد منفی تایپ کنید، می‌توانید یکان یا دهگان و ... را به جای بخش‌های پس از اعشار تغییر بدهید.

روش کار مشابه است: ابتدا سلول موردنظر را انتخاب کنید.

آموزش حذف اعشار و گرد یا رند کردن اعداد در Excel با تابع ROUND

در منوی Formulas روی Math & Trig کلیک کنید و یکی از توابع ROUNDDOWN یا ROUNDUP را انتخاب کنید.

آموزش حذف اعشار و گرد یا رند کردن اعداد در Excel با تابع ROUND

در فیلد Number عددی را تایپ کنید و یا سلول مبدأ حاوی عدد اصلی را انتخاب کنید. در فیلد Num_digits نیز تعداد ارقام لازم را مشخص کنید. با کلیک روی OK، تابع در سلول انتخاب‌شده نوشته می‌شود.

آموزش حذف اعشار و گرد یا رند کردن اعداد در Excel با تابع ROUND